using Playnite.Native; using System.Linq; using System.Runtime.InteropServices; using System.Text; using System.Text.RegularExpressions; namespace System.Diagnostics { public static class ProcessExtensions { public static bool TryGetMainModuleFileName(this Process process, out string fileName, int buffer = 1024) { fileName = null; var handle = Kernel32.OpenProcess(ProcessAccessFlags.QueryLimitedInformation, false, process.Id); if (handle == IntPtr.Zero) { return false; } try { var fileNameBuilder = new StringBuilder(buffer); uint bufferLength = (uint)fileNameBuilder.Capacity + 1; var result = Kernel32.QueryFullProcessImageName(handle, 0, fileNameBuilder, ref bufferLength); fileName = result ? fileNameBuilder.ToString() : null; return result; } finally { Kernel32.CloseHandle(handle); } } public static bool TryGetParentId(this Process process, out int processId) { processId = 0; var handle = Kernel32.OpenProcess(ProcessAccessFlags.QueryLimitedInformation, false, process.Id); if (handle == IntPtr.Zero) { return false; } try { var info = new PROCESS_BASIC_INFORMATION(); int status = Ntdll.NtQueryInformationProcess(handle, 0, ref info, Marshal.SizeOf(info), out var returnLength); if (status != 0) { return false; } processId = info.InheritedFromUniqueProcessId.ToInt32(); return true; } finally { Kernel32.CloseHandle(handle); } } public static bool IsRunning(string processPattern) { return Process.GetProcesses().FirstOrDefault(a => Regex.IsMatch(a.ProcessName, processPattern, RegexOptions.IgnoreCase)) != null; } } }
